Possible Engine Transition


Hello! As some of you may know we’ve been using Quest to make our games, but I’ve started too feel that it takes over the game too much. It’s not as much a World of Exshire game as it is a Quest game. We will continue making WOE and Dead Lands in Quest, but later games will probably in another engine. One of the biggest downfalls of this is that you need to download Quest to run the games. You can download Quest here. It’s easy to download and only takes a minute, so if you want to play the early access version, then you must download this program. I know it stinks, but it’s just another reason for a possible engine switch for later games.
